WebMar 1, 2024 · Here are the best strategies to graduate college within four years. 1. Plan Ahead. Most college students earn 30 credits per year, and a bachelor's degree requires a minimum of 120 credits. WebMar 29, 2024 · Usually, graduating college with honors is only helpful to a graduate in landing the first two jobs. Many dream of earning both a college degree and honors. However, only a few can turn it into a reality — only about 20% to 30% of all undergraduate students graduate summa cum laude, magna cum laude or cum laude.
